ITB #22-0090 - Richland Library STEAM Space Improvements
Public notice is hereby given that bids will be received for the City of Richland’s RICHLAND LIBRARY STEAM SPACE IMPROVEMENTS Project by the City of Richland Purchasing Division until the date and time specified above, at which time bids will be opened and read publicly. This project includes but is not limited to the renovations of approximately 2,127 SF of an area inside the Richland Public Library referred to as the STEAM Space as well as some updates to an outdoor landing area outside of the STEAM space. Interior renovations include concrete polishing, new floor box electrical outlets, painting, casework, a new range hood above the oven, and necessary demolition. Exterior renovations include some new concrete flatwork, light veneer work for new seating benches composed from existing veneer wall, and necessary demolition. This project also recognizes an Alternate 1 that includes new mechanical components in the STEAM space as identified in the plans. This project is estimated at $190,000 to $240,000.
